Scripted Illusion

The spell caster creates an illusion that will start with or react to somebody’s actions. For example, the illusion might suddenly show a firewall at a certain time of day, or a sleeping dragon that wakes up when somebody walks nearby.   Save: Will save vs. spell check DC to disbelieve

Effect

1 Lost, failure, Roll 1d4 modified by Luck: (1 or less) corruption + misfire; (2-3) corruption; (4+) misfire.
2 - 11 Lost. Failure.
12 - 13 Failure, but spell is not lost.
14 - 19 The illusion follows the planned script. The illusion may affect an area up to a 5’ sq. for 1 turn.
20 - 25 The illusion follows the planned script. The area affected may be up to a 10’ sq. and can last for 1d3 turns.
26 - 31 The illusion follows the planned script, affects an area up to 20’ sq. and lasts for 1 hour. It is particularly realistic and adversaries failing a DC 15 Will check will flee in fear, be charmed, etc. (depending on the actual form/script).
32 - 33 The illusion follows the planned script, affects an area up to 40’ sq. and lasts for 1 week. It is particularly realistic and adversaries failing a DC 20 Will check will flee in fear, be charmed, etc. (depending on the actual form/script).
34+ The scripted illusion can become permanent. It can affect an area up to 100’ sq. It is particularly realistic and adversaries failing a DC 25 Will check will flee in fear, be charmed, etc. (depending on the actual form/script).

Side/Secondary Effects

Corruption

Roll 1d3: (1) caster’s eyes become permanently transparent, and he is blind for 1d5 rounds; (2) caster’s body becomes ethereal for 1d5 hours every day; (3) caster becomes covered in small bumps that resemble small pox or toad skin that the caster can’t see.  

Misfire

Roll 1d3: (1) the illusion appears to work, but only works for the caster; (2) the illusion script is reversed (e.g. the dragon goes to sleep when somebody walks near (3) the illusion becomes a colorful blur starting at the left foot of the caster and follows him for 1d5 hours.
Effect Duration
Varies
Effect Casting Time
1 Action
Range
100’+20’ per CL (once the spell is cast, the caster can move away.)
Level
2
